The Pitt is an affectionate but also symbolic name for their ER because it’s short for Pittsburgh but also because it's seen as a chaotic, intense, non-stop environment where doctors and nurses are thrown into the craziness, dealing with everything from minor injuries to major trauma, often feeling like they are in a "pit" of stress and demands, or even purgatory. It reflects the overwhelming workload and the feeling of being in the thick of medical emergencies.
